JOHN TRAVOLTA | MAINE | $5 MILLION

John Travolta placed his Maine retreat on the market for $5 million, and it’s pretty cheap compared to its features and size. You can mistake his home for a hotel with its expansive gigantic dimensions, not to mention its stunning look. The legendary actor bought this home with his late wife, Kelly Preston, when they were newlyweds at an unknown price. Located off the coast of Maine, it was the perfect place for the couple with the incredible degree of its calm and peaceful surroundings.

Their former holiday home boasts huge spaces filled with natural light. It is about more than 10,000 square feet of colorful and cozy bliss, a far cry from its old dark and somber look. John and Kelly put a piece of them in this home, personally designing every inch of it by getting inspiration from different magazines. Did you know that they even camped out in a small farmhouse to monitor its renovation? That’s how dedicated John and Kelly were to this home.
